Classes are scheduled to meet the credit requirements submitted to the Iowa Department of Education. Faculty are expected to adhere to class schedules and meet the identified class, lab, clinical, or work based learning time allocations regardless of the class delivery method. Holding class later than scheduled or letting class out early without approval from the Dean is not acceptable.
The credit hour breakdown for each course is listed in the college catalog at the end of the course description. For example, (68/8) means 68 theory hours and 8 lab hours. Clinical and Coop hours are identified in the college catalog.
In instances when a class does not meet due to campus closings, it is the instructor’s obligation to see that course guide objectives are met by students. All faculty are required to post course materials and assignment in Brightspace to provide class delivery through synchronous online methods. In addition, outside assignments may be given to cover necessary material, or arrangements can be made with students to make up the time if deemed necessary.
All changes in class schedules and course delivery methods must be pre-approved by the Department Dean.
